Andonis Cafe & Bar in Stretton is a lively Greek-fusion brunch spot on Beenleigh Road that has gone out of its way to court dog owners, right down to printing a doggy menu. It is one of the more genuinely dog-friendly cafes in the area rather than just tolerant of a lead under the table.

Dog access and setup. Dogs are welcome in the outdoor alfresco area, which is where the on-site car park opens straight onto. Indoors is set up for humans only, so plan on the courtyard regardless of weather. Staff keep dogs on lead in the outdoor zone. The standout feature is the dedicated doggy menu: Puppelato (a bacon-infused coconut gelato) at 9.99 dollars, a Doggy Latte at 4.99 dollars, Pupcakes at 12.99 dollars, and a Little Paw Benedict at 5.99 dollars, so bring the appetite for your dog as well as yourself.

Known for. Big, colourful Greek-inspired brunch plates, generous portions, and an Instagram-friendly presentation that extends to the dog dishes. Expect a busy, family-friendly buzz rather than a quiet corner cafe.

Getting there and parking. Andonis is at 3/1155 Beenleigh Road, Stretton, just off the M1, with an on-site car park plus street parking on nearby roads. The outdoor seating is accessed directly from the car park, handy if you are juggling a dog and a pram.

Nearby with the dogs. Karawatha Forest Park has on-leash walking trails a short drive away, and Runcorn Heights Park is close enough for a post-brunch stretch of the legs.

Go early on weekends if you want a table in the courtyard, since the doggy menu and brunch reputation both draw a crowd. Good for owners who want their dog to genuinely share the outing, not just tag along.
